Ignore:
Timestamp:
03/21/2004 07:27:22 PM (20 years ago)
Author:
Tushar Teredesai <tushar@…>
Branches:
10.0, 10.1, 11.0, 11.1, 11.2, 11.3, 12.0, 12.1, 6.0, 6.1, 6.2, 6.2.0, 6.2.0-rc1, 6.2.0-rc2, 6.3, 6.3-rc1, 6.3-rc2, 6.3-rc3, 7.10, 7.4, 7.5, 7.6, 7.6-blfs, 7.6-systemd, 7.7, 7.8, 7.9, 8.0, 8.1, 8.2, 8.3, 8.4, 9.0, 9.1, basic, bdubbs/svn, elogind, gnome, kde5-13430, kde5-14269, kde5-14686, kea, ken/TL2024, ken/inkscape-core-mods, ken/tuningfonts, krejzi/svn, lazarus, lxqt, nosym, perl-modules, plabs/newcss, plabs/python-mods, python3.11, qt5new, rahul/power-profiles-daemon, renodr/vulkan-addition, systemd-11177, systemd-13485, trunk, upgradedb, v5_1, v5_1-pre1, xry111/intltool, xry111/llvm18, xry111/soup3, xry111/test-20220226, xry111/xf86-video-removal
Children:
cc265e51
Parents:
f53f1b3c
Message:

The march to lfs-bootscripts begins

git-svn-id: svn://svn.linuxfromscratch.org/BLFS/trunk/BOOK@1906 af4574ff-66df-0310-9fd7-8a98e5e911e0

File:
1 edited

Legend:

Unmodified
Added
Removed
  • introduction/important/beyond.xml

    rf53f1b3c rb5ea3492  
    99</para>
    1010
    11 <para>If you are installing a package in a non-standard prefix, <xref
    12 linkend="appendices-generic"/> checklist will be helpful if the
    13 package does not work as expected.</para>
     11<para>When you want to install a package to a location other than
     12<filename class='directory'>/</filename>, or <filename class='directory'>/usr</filename>, you are installing
     13outside the default environment settings on most machines.  The following
     14examples should assist you in determining how to correct this situation.
     15The examples cover the complete range of settings that may need
     16updating, but they are not all needed in every situation.</para>
     17
     18<itemizedlist>
     19<listitem><para>Expand the <envar>PATH</envar> to include
     20<filename class='directory'>$PREFIX/bin</filename>.</para></listitem>
     21<listitem><para>Expand the <envar>PATH</envar> for root to include
     22<filename class='directory'>$PREFIX/sbin</filename>.</para></listitem>
     23<listitem><para>Add <filename class='directory'>$PREFIX/lib</filename>
     24to <filename>/etc/ld.so.conf</filename> or expand
     25<envar>LD_LIBRARY_PATH</envar> to include it. Before using the latter option,
     26check out <ulink url="http://www.visi.com/~barr/ldpath.html"/>. If you
     27modify <filename>/etc/ld.so.conf</filename> remember to update
     28<filename>/etc/ld.so.cache</filename> by executing <command>ldconfig</command>.</para></listitem>
     29<listitem><para>Add <filename class='directory'>$PREFIX/man</filename>
     30to <filename>/etc/man.conf</filename> or expand <envar>MANPATH</envar>.</para></listitem>
     31<listitem><para>Add <filename class='directory'>$PREFIX/info</filename>
     32to <envar>INFOPATH</envar>.</para></listitem>
     33<listitem><para>Add <filename
     34class='directory'>$PREFIX/lib/pkgconfig</filename> to
     35<envar>PKG_CONFIG_PATH</envar>.</para></listitem>
     36<listitem><para>Add <filename
     37class='directory'>$PREFIX/include</filename> to <envar>CPPFLAGS</envar> when compiling packages
     38that depend on the package you installed.</para></listitem>
     39</itemizedlist>
    1440
    1541<para>If you are in search of a package that is not in the book, the following
Note: See TracChangeset for help on using the changeset viewer.